Double Car Door
Double-car doors, usually 16 feet wide, are the standard for Helotes’s larger homes built after 2000. These doors are heavy. The torsion spring system must be calibrated precisely, especially on a frame that’s settled even slightly out of square. We’ve replaced too many prematurely failed springs on 16-foot doors in Helotes to trust generic hardware. We measure the opening, check the slab level, and spec the spring weight to match actual conditions - not the original blueprint.

Steel Doors
Steel remains the practical choice for most Helotes installations. Insulated double-layer steel handles the summer heat without warping, resists denting from wind-borne debris, and seals tightly against cedar pollen when the weatherstripping is fitted correctly. We carry Clopay and Wayne Dalton steel lines in our trucks, with panel styles from flush to recessed carriage-house. For exposed lots on the escarpment, we recommend wind-rated models with reinforced struts.

Wood Doors
Wood doors suit the Hill Country architecture common in Helotes’s custom builds and older homes near the historic district. Cedar and mahogany hold up well if maintained, but they demand precise installation to prevent moisture intrusion at the bottom panel. We seal all wood door installations with aluminum thresholds and proper drainage slopes, especially critical on Helotes’s limestone slabs where water can pool unevenly.

Common Garage Door Installation Problems We See in Helotes Homes
- Differential slab settling on limestone cut-fill lots throws door tracks out of plumb. The Balcones Escarpment geology means many Helotes garage slabs were poured on uncompacted fill over bedrock. Within five to ten years, the slab tilts or sinks on one side, racking the door frame and causing the door to bind or drag. We measure with a laser level and shim or reframe as needed before hanging the new door.
- Sustained Hill Country ridge winds fatigue torsion springs faster than in sheltered neighborhoods. Helotes’s elevated, open terrain exposes garage doors to wind gusts that San Antonio’s valley floors don’t see. Standard springs rated for moderate wind loads fail early here. We spec heavier-gauge springs and wind-rated hardware on every Helotes installation.
- Cedar pollen coats sensors and tracks during December-February, causing false reversals. The surrounding Hill Country cedar stands release pollen that blankets Helotes more heavily than most of metro San Antonio. Homeowners often blame the opener or track alignment when the real issue is a gummed photo-eye sensor. During winter installations and service calls, we clean and align sensors as standard practice.
- Thermal expansion in steel panel seams causes noise and binding in triple-digit heat. Helotes summer temperatures routinely crack 100 degrees, expanding steel panels and drying lubricant in torsion springs. Proper gap tolerances during installation prevent summer binding, and we use high-temperature grease on spring systems.
Pricing for Garage Door Installation in Helotes, TX
A typical new garage door installation in Helotes runs $700-$2,200 depending on door size, material, insulation level, and whether the opening needs reframing. Single-car steel doors fall at the lower end; insulated double-car or custom wood doors at the upper. Foundation settling issues common on Helotes limestone lots may add $150-$400 for shimming, header repair, or track realignment if the existing frame is badly racked.
| Service | Price Range in Helotes |
|---|---|
| New Door Installation | $700 - $2,200 |
| Opener Installation (if needed) | $250 - $550 |
| Track Realignment / Frame Shimming | $120 - $240 |
| Spring Repair (existing door) | $180 - $340 |
